Batteries additionally facilitate the use of electric motors, which have their own advantages. On the opposite hand, batteries have low energy densities, quick service life, poor performance at extreme temperatures, lengthy charging instances, and difficulties with disposal (though they’ll usually be recycled). Like gas, batteries retailer chemical vitality and may cause burns and poisoning in occasion of an accident. The concern of charge time could be resolved by swapping discharged batteries with charged ones; however, this incurs further hardware prices and could also be impractical for bigger batteries. Moreover, there have to be normal batteries for battery swapping to work at a fuel station.

In aircraft, air brakes are aerodynamic surfaces that create friction, with the air flow inflicting the automobile to sluggish. These are normally applied as flaps that oppose air circulate when extended and are flush with plane when retracted. Propeller aircraft achieve reverse thrust by reversing the pitch of the propellers, while jet aircraft achieve this by redirecting their engine exhaust forwards. On aircraft carriers, arresting gears are used to cease an aircraft.
